A robust approach to detect intersections between triangles with different numerical representations

dc.contributor.authorGarau, Luca
dc.contributor.authorCherchi, Gianmarco
dc.contributor.editorSkala, Václav
dc.date.accessioned2025-07-30T09:11:55Z
dc.date.available2025-07-30T09:11:55Z
dc.date.issued2025
dc.description.abstract-translatedThe detection and classification of intersections between triangles are crucial tasks in a wide range of applications within Computer Graphics and Geometry Processing, including mesh Arrangements, mesh Booleans, and generic mesh processing and fixing tasks. Existing methods are hard-coded and deeply integrated into specific algorithms, and significant efforts are usually required to integrate them into new pipelines or to extend them to different numerical representations. This paper presents a versatile and exhaustive algorithm to identify and classify intersections between triangles with either floating points, rational numbers, or implicit representations. The proposed tool is implemented as a C++ templated and header-only code that is generic and easy to integrate into further algorithms requiring the triangle-triangle intersection detection step. The developed tool has been tested and compared with a state-of-the-art approach, and it is shared with the Geometry Processing community with an Open Source license.en
dc.format10 s.cs
dc.format.mimetypeapplication/pdf
dc.identifier.doihttp://www.doi.org/10.24132/CSRN.2025-7
dc.identifier.issn2464-4617 (Print)
dc.identifier.issn2464-4625 (online)
dc.identifier.urihttp://hdl.handle.net/11025/62213
dc.language.isoenen
dc.publisherVaclav Skala - UNION Agencyen
dc.rights© Vaclav Skala - UNION Agencyen
dc.rights.accessopenAccessen
dc.subjectrobustní zpracování geometriecs
dc.subjectprůniky trojúhelníkůcs
dc.subjectdetekce kolizícs
dc.subjectuspořádání sítícs
dc.subjectpřesná aritmetikacs
dc.subjectimplicitní reprezentacecs
dc.subject.translatedrobust geometry processingen
dc.subject.translatedtriangle-triangle intersectionsen
dc.subject.translatedcollision detectionen
dc.subject.translatedmesh arrangementsen
dc.subject.translatedexact arithmeticen
dc.subject.translatedimplicit representationsen
dc.titleA robust approach to detect intersections between triangles with different numerical representationsen
dc.typekonferenční příspěvekcs
dc.typeconferenceObjecten
dc.type.statusPeer revieweden
dc.type.versionpublishedVersionen
local.files.count1*
local.files.size4532883*
local.has.filesyes*

Files

Original bundle
Showing 1 - 1 out of 1 results
No Thumbnail Available
Name:
A83.pdf
Size:
4.32 MB
Format:
Adobe Portable Document Format
License bundle
Showing 1 - 1 out of 1 results
No Thumbnail Available
Name:
license.txt
Size:
1.71 KB
Format:
Item-specific license agreed upon to submission
Description: